Description:
The “Smart Waste Level Alert and Intimation System for Municipality” is an innovative working model designed for students to understand how smart waste management systems can help municipalities optimize garbage collection and reduce overflow issues. This project demonstrates an automated system that detects waste levels in a dustbin and sends an alert when it reaches a certain threshold.
The model is built on a 40 × 50 cm Foam Board or Sun Board base, with artificial plants added for visual enhancement. The IR sensor is placed inside the bin to detect the waste level. When the bin fills up, the BC547 transistor and 5V relay activate an LED indicator, signaling that the bin needs to be emptied. The 7805 voltage regulator ensures a stable 5V power supply, while the IN4007 diode protects the circuit from voltage surges. Resistors control current flow, and connecting wires establish connections between the components.
Additional elements like straws and battery clips are used to secure the wiring and structure. This project provides students with hands-on learning in automation, electronics, and smart city innovations, showcasing how municipalities can implement IoT-based waste management systems to enhance cleanliness and efficiency.
